Israeli Attack on Gaza School Shelter Kills 10, Including Child

At least 10 people were killed in an attack by Israel that started a fire in a school sheltering people in Gaza City. The attack happened at a school where people who had to leave their homes were staying. Among those who died was a child who got burned in the fire.

The Palestinian Civil Defence said that its workers found 10 bodies early on Wednesday after the attack. Many other people were hurt, and the Civil Defence shared this information on Telegram, a messaging app.

A reporter for Al Jazeera named Anas al-Sharif shared on social media that children were burned while they were sleeping in the tents at the shelter. He said there were no safe places left and that Gaza City and its northern areas had been hit by strong shelling and bomb attacks for many hours.

Videos posted on social media showed tents burning, and the fire melting the canvas covering the tents. Some chairs and a bed frame were also burned in the fire.

The Civil Defence also asked the Red Cross for help because people were trapped under the rubble of houses in Gaza City's Tuffah neighborhood. They said that workers could not get to the area because it was too dangerous, and the Israeli forces had made it a place where no one could go.

Al Jazeera Arabic also reported that a child was killed in another attack on Wednesday in the Jabalia refugee camp in northern Gaza. Two people died in this attack, and many were hurt.

One more person was killed and several others were injured in another Israeli attack on tent shelters in the al-Mawasi “safe zone,” which is south of Khan Younis in southern Gaza.

There were also many airstrikes and artillery fire across Gaza in the early morning hours, making the situation even worse for people living in the area.
